April gets started with the 25th Annual Camellia Classic Open Car Show at Bellingrath Gardens & Home near Mobile. From the Gulf Shores area you can take the Mobile Bay Ferry or enjoy a leisurely drive north to cross the bay on I-10 or the Causeway.
The show will feature hundreds of vintage automobiles on the Great Lawn. Bring a canned good to donate to Feeding the Gulf Coast to receive $1 off admission. This discount is only applicable for Gardens-only tickets purchased at Bellingrath on the day of the event.

For spicy fun, check out the Waterway Village Zydeco & Crawfish Festival on April 14. The festival promises to boil up plenty of fun. Sink your teeth into some hot, juicy, lip-smacking crawfish while dancing to the infectious rhythms of some of the best Zydeco bands from around the South. There will be crawfish races, arts and crafts vendors, children's activities and even an authentic 80-foot shrimp boat on hand offering nonstop fun for all ages.
If your spring isn’t in high gear by April 28, it will be with the Interstate Mullet Toss and Gulf Coast's Greatest Beach Party at the Flora-Bama! Those who participate in the Mullet Toss will throw a dead mullet over the state line of Florida and Alabama to see who gets the farthest. April winds down the same way it revved up, with a great car show. This time the glistening chrome, candy apple red, marina blue and Daytona yellow can be found at the 9th Annual Bama Coast Cruise at the Wharf Resort in Orange Beach, April 28 – 30.
Bama Coast Cruise is an absolutely stunning show, set against the backdrop of the Intracoastal Waterway and the Canal Bridge. It's a laid back, family friendly weekend full of amazing cars, fun events, entertainment and Southern hospitality. Bama Coast Cruise will be open to spectators Friday and Saturday from 9:00 am until 5:00 pm.
